to be that low, it would need to have had some work on the beam. get unnder the front and take a look at the two large pipes running accros the front.
in the middle there might be what looks like a bolt on a plate attached to each. this is an adjuster. you can then re set the height. if it hasnt got
these, then i dont know... but i am sure there would be some one on here that will be able ot help.
the back is real easy. its jsut a matter of adjsut ing the torsion bar. i would wait a few days and talk to some one local form on here. they may be
able to offer you some assistance. i know i would if you were up this way. good luck
